Popular Nigerian musician Kingsley Okonkwo, also known as Kcee, has disclosed that his journey in the music industry began as a disc jockey.

During a recent episode of the Afrobeats Podcast, the artiste, famous for hits like ‘Limpopo,’ shared that both he and his brother, Emeka Okonkwo, widely known as E-Money and co-founder of Five Star Music, initially pursued careers as DJs before transitioning to music.

Reflecting on his upbringing, Kcee revealed, “My father was a DJ, a record seller. I grew up in a home where my father sold records. So all the old-school artistes, I know them [their music]. I was selling their records when I was about 5 or 6 years old.

“When I was in secondary school, I was already handling a full record store and playing at parties. I and E-Money were DJs. So, I listened to a lot of artists.”

He attributed much of his musical foundation to his father’s influence, acknowledging him as a significant factor in shaping his career path.

Kcee also revealed that the secret to his longevity in the music industry is his “ear for a hit song.”
